RESOLVED, that Glen Triviski dba Manor Restaurant
be permitted to install and operate a customer - employee
parking lot for 19 cars on the southwest corner of
West Seventh and Davern Streets, more particularly described
I
as Lot 1 and the east one -half of Lot 2, Thomas E. Sime's
subdivision of lot 1 block 8 Hbmecroft, an addition to
St. Paul, in accordance with plans approved February 15,
1962, subject to compliance with the provisions of all
ordinances governing the operation of parking lots, and to the
condition that the sidewalk abutting said premises be kept
clean and free of ice and snow at all times.

This is in the matter of the application of the Manor Restaurant for
a 19 car off - street parking lot on property located at the southwest
corner of'West Seventh and Davern Streets. The property is described
as Lot l and the east one -half of Lot 2, Thos.'E. Simes Suit. of
Block 8, Homecroft Addition. The zoning is commercial.
The site is presently vacant and the applicant proposes to develop
it with a 19 car off - street parking lot to be used in conjunction
with the Manor Restaurant. This is an irregularly shaped tract of
land having a frontage of 108 feet on West Seventh Street and 159.6
feet on Davern Street resulting in an area of approximately 10,320
square feet. West and adjoining is the applicant's restaurant which
fronts on West Seventh Street; north and across West Seventh Street
is vacant land; east and across Davern Street is a filling station
which fronts on both Davern and West Seventh Streets, and vacant
land which fronts on Davern Streit; south and directly adjoining is
vacant land, farther south is a single - family residence which fronts
on Davern Street.
Field investigation discloses no objection to this proposal. The
Traffic Engineer has approved the plan which meets the standards
for this type of facility.
In consideration of the above factors, the Board of Zoning recommends
the granting of the application for a 19 car off-street parking lot
on the above described property in accordance with plans approved
February 15, 1962.
